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market Overview

  • The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market is valued at USD 150 million,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ing demand for efficient resource management, the rise of smart city initiatives, and the adoption of IoT technologies in utility services. The integration of cloud-based solutions has enabled utilities to harness data analytics for improved decision-making and operational efficiency.
  • Key players in this market include Manama, the capital city, which serves as a hub for technological innovation and investment in smart utilities. Additionally, cities like Riffa and Muharraq are also significant contributors due to their growing urban populations and infrastructure development projects that necessitate advanced data analytics solutions.
  • In 2023, the Bahraini government implemented a regulatory framework aimed at promoting the use of cloud-based data analytics in utilities. This framework includes guidelines for data privacy, security standards, and incentives for utility companies to adopt innovative technologies, thereby enhancing the overall efficiency and sustainability of utility services in the region.

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market Segmentation

By Type:The market is segmented into various types of analytics solutions that cater to the needs of smart utilities. The subsegments include Predictive Analytics, Descriptive Analytics, Prescriptive Analytics, Data Visualization Tools, Reporting Solutions, and Others. Each of these subsegments plays a crucial role in enhancing operational efficiency and decision-making processes within utility companies.

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market segmentation by Type.

The dominant subsegment in the market is Predictive Analytics, which is increasingly utilized by utility companies to forecast demand, optimize resource allocation, and enhance service delivery. This trend is driven by the growing need for data-driven decision-making and the ability to leverage historical data for future planning. As utilities face challenges such as fluctuating demand and resource constraints, predictive analytics provides valuable insights that help in mitigating risks and improving operational efficiency.

By End-User:The market is segmented based on the end-users of cloud-based data analytics solutions, which include Residential, Commercial, Industrial, and Government & Utilities. Each end-user segment has unique requirements and applications for data analytics, influencing the overall market dynamics.

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market segmentation by End-User.

The Industrial segment is the leading end-user in the market, driven by the need for efficient energy management and operational optimization. Industries are increasingly adopting cloud-based data analytics to monitor energy consumption, reduce waste, and comply with regulatory standards. The growing emphasis on sustainability and cost reduction further propels the demand for advanced analytics solutions in this sector.

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ing Demand for Real-Time Data Analytics:The demand for real-time data analytics in Bahrain's utility sector is surging, driven by the need for immediate insights to enhance service delivery. In future, the utility sector is projected to invest approximately $180 million in data analytics technologies, reflecting a 20% increase from previous years. This investment is crucial for optimizing resource allocation and improving customer satisfaction, as utilities seek to leverage data for operational excellence and competitive advantage.
  • Government Initiatives for Smart Utility Transformation:The Bahraini government is actively promoting smart utility initiatives, with a budget allocation of $250 million for smart grid projects in future. These initiatives aim to modernize infrastructure and enhance energy efficiency. The government's commitment to sustainability and innovation is expected to drive the adoption of cloud-based data analytics, enabling utilities to better manage resources and reduce operational costs while meeting regulatory requirements.
  • Rising Adoption of IoT in Utility Management:The integration of Internet of Things (IoT) technologies in utility management is gaining momentum, with an estimated 2 million IoT devices expected to be deployed in Bahrain's utilities in future. This growth is anticipated to enhance data collection and analysis capabilities, allowing utilities to monitor systems in real-time. The increased connectivity will facilitate proactive maintenance and improve service reliability, ultimately benefiting consumers and utility providers alike.

Market Challenges

  • Data Privacy and Security Concerns:As utilities increasingly rely on cloud-based data analytics, concerns regarding data privacy and security are escalating. In future, it is estimated that 70% of utility companies in Bahrain will face regulatory scrutiny related to data protection. The potential for data breaches poses significant risks, leading to increased costs for compliance and mitigation strategies, which can hinder the adoption of innovative analytics solutions.
  • High Initial Investment Costs:The initial investment required for implementing cloud-based data analytics solutions can be a significant barrier for many utility companies. In future, the average cost of deploying these systems is projected to be around $1.2 million per utility, which may deter smaller companies from adopting advanced analytics. This financial challenge can limit the overall growth of the market, as not all utilities can afford the upfront costs associated with these technologies.

Bahrain Cloud-Based Data Analytics for Smart Utilities Market Future Outlook

The future of Bahrain's cloud-based data analytics for smart utilities market appears promising, driven by technological advancements and increasing government support. As utilities continue to embrace digital transformation, the integration of AI and machine learning will enhance predictive analytics capabilities. Furthermore, the growing emphasis on sustainability will push utilities to adopt innovative solutions that optimize energy consumption and reduce waste. This evolving landscape will create a fertile ground for new entrants and established players to innovate and expand their offerings.

Market Opportunities

  • Expansion of Cloud Infrastructure:The ongoing expansion of cloud infrastructure in Bahrain presents a significant opportunity for utility companies. With investments projected to reach $120 million in future, utilities can leverage enhanced cloud capabilities to improve data storage and processing, leading to more efficient analytics and decision-making processes.
  • Partnerships with Technology Providers:Collaborating with technology providers can unlock new opportunities for utilities in Bahrain. By forming strategic partnerships, utilities can access cutting-edge analytics tools and expertise, facilitating the development of customized solutions that address specific operational challenges and enhance service delivery.
